在网页设计中,调整标签的宽度和高度是常见的操作,可以让网页布局更加美观和实用。jQuery作为一个强大的JavaScript库,为我们提供了丰富的选择器和方法,使得调整标签的宽高变得轻松简单。本文将详细介绍如何使用jQuery来调整标签的宽高,并分享一些实用的网页布局美化技巧。
一、使用jQuery调整标签宽高
1. 获取标签的宽度和高度
在调整标签的宽度和高度之前,我们首先需要获取标签的当前宽度和高度。jQuery提供了.width()和.height()方法来获取元素的宽度和高度。
// 获取元素宽度
var width = $('#element').width();
// 获取元素高度
var height = $('#element').height();
2. 设置标签的宽度和高度
获取到标签的宽度和高度后,我们可以使用.width()和.height()方法来设置新的宽度和高度。
// 设置元素宽度为200px
$('#element').width(200);
// 设置元素高度为100px
$('#element').height(100);
3. 动态调整标签宽高
有时候,我们可能需要在页面加载、窗口大小改变等情况下动态调整标签的宽度和高度。这时,我们可以使用jQuery的.animate()方法来实现。
// 动态调整元素宽度为300px,高度为150px
$('#element').animate({
width: 300,
height: 150
}, 1000);
二、网页布局美化技巧
1. 使用响应式设计
随着移动设备的普及,响应式设计已经成为网页设计的重要趋势。使用jQuery可以轻松实现响应式布局,让网页在不同设备上都能保持良好的显示效果。
$(window).resize(function() {
// 在窗口大小改变时调整元素宽高
$('#element').width($(window).width() * 0.5);
$('#element').height($(window).height() * 0.5);
});
2. 利用CSS3动画
CSS3动画可以让网页更加生动有趣。结合jQuery,我们可以实现更加丰富的动画效果。
// 使用CSS3动画改变元素宽高
$('#element').css({
transition: 'width 1s, height 1s',
width: 200,
height: 100
});
3. 优化网页性能
在调整标签宽高时,我们还需要注意网页性能。过多的DOM操作和动画效果可能会影响页面加载速度。为了优化网页性能,我们可以采取以下措施:
- 使用CSS3代替JavaScript动画
- 减少DOM操作次数
- 使用缓存技术
三、总结
使用jQuery调整标签宽高,可以让我们更加轻松地实现网页布局美化。通过本文的介绍,相信你已经掌握了使用jQuery调整标签宽高的方法,并了解了网页布局美化的一些实用技巧。在实际开发中,我们可以根据具体需求,灵活运用这些方法,打造出美观、实用的网页作品。
